External Regeneration Resistor Specifications

If the Servomotor's regenerative energy is excessive, connect an External
Regeneration Resistor.
Note 1. External Regeneration Resistors cannot be connected to Servo Drivers of between 30 to
200 W.
Connection to a 400-W Servo Driver is usually not required. If the Servomotor's regenerative
energy is excessive, connect an External Regeneration Resistor between B1 and B2.
For a 750-W Servo Driver, B2 and B3 are normally short-circuited. If the Servomotor's re-
generative energy is excessive, remove the short bar between B2 and B3 and connect an
External Regeneration Resistor between B1 and B2.
Note 2. Refer to Surge Absorbers for External Regeneration Resistor selection details.

R88A-RR22047S External Regeneration Resistor

Specifications
Model
Resistance
R88A-RR22047S 47 Ω ± 5%
